Surface Preparation: The Foundation of Success

This is arguably the most important part of the whole job. You can have the best coating in the world, but if it’s applied to a dirty, oily, or crumbly surface, it won’t stick properly. We use specialized equipment to grind down your concrete, cleaning it thoroughly and creating a profile that allows the coating to penetrate and bond.

This grinding process also helps to seal any minor imperfections and ensure a perfectly smooth canvas for the final layers. We remove any existing sealers, glues, or contaminants that could interfere with the adhesion of our high-performance system. It’s all about setting the stage for a truly superior result.

Applying the Layers: Artistry Meets Science

Once the surface is prepped and pristine, we begin the application of the coating itself. This usually involves a base coat, which provides the primary protection and color, followed by decorative elements like flakes if you choose them, and then a clear topcoat for maximum durability and gloss.

Our skilled technicians apply these layers with precision, ensuring even coverage and a seamless finish. We work methodically, paying attention to every detail to avoid imperfections and create that stunning, professional look you’re after. The Curing Process: Patience Pays Off

After the final layer is applied, the coating needs time to cure and harden. This isn’t instant. It’s a chemical process that ensures the coating reaches its full strength and resilience. We’ll advise you on the specific drying and curing times, usually a couple of days before you can walk on it and a bit longer before you can park vehicles or place heavy items back.

Following these guidelines is super important for the longevity of your new floor. Rushing the process can compromise the integrity of the coating, so a little patience here guarantees a long-lasting, beautiful surface for years to come.

Epoxy floor coating is a multi-coat resin system applied directly over a prepared slab. The chemistry bonds at a molecular level with the concrete and cures into a rigid, chemical-resistant surface several times harder than the slab beneath.

Contractor applying epoxy coating

Most modern systems are 80 to 100 mil thick once cured. The visual hallmark is a glossy mirror finish, often with decorative flake or metallic. Beyond the look, the slab is now sealed: motor oil, brake fluid, road salt and acid spills wipe off instead of soaking in.

Installation process in Alpha, Minnesota

Metallic flake epoxy detail
  1. Phone quote.Square footage, slab condition, finish preference. Most quotes are firm after one call and a couple of photos.
  2. Surface prep.Diamond grinding or shot blasting opens the pores. Cracks routed and filled. This is where most failed coatings fail, installers in Alpha and the surrounding area do not skip it.
  3. Coats applied.Primer, basecoat, flake or metallic broadcast, then a UV-stable topcoat. Professional-grade two-part resins.
  4. Cure and handover.Foot-traffic in 24 hours, vehicles in 72. Before-and-after photos and warranty paperwork delivered with the keys.

How much does epoxy flooring cost in Alpha, Minnesota?

Residential garages typically run $4 to $10 per square foot installed, depending on finish complexity and prep needed. A two-car garage usually lands between $1,800 and $4,500. The phone quote is firm before any deposit is taken.

How long does the coating last?

A properly prepped professional-grade install lasts 15 to 25 years in residential garage use. heavy-traffic floors are warrantied for 10 years. The 5-year written warranty covers adhesion and chip-out from the slab.

How long until I can park on it?

Foot traffic in 24 hours, full vehicle traffic at 72 hours. Hot-tire pickup is not a concern with professional-grade resins.
